environment. About Earth System
We are building Earth-System (https://allenai.org/earth-system), a new platform for large-scale planetary intelligence. Our mission is to tackle some of the world’s most complex environmental challenges—spanning climate change, sustainability, food security, humanitarian aid, and conservation—through AI. This platform will combine
highly mixed-modality geospatial foundation models
with the infrastructure to fine-tune and deploy them at scale. Our models analyze many different types of planetary data including satellite imagery, elevation maps, super-resolution weather forecasts, and other geospatial data sources for tasks such as ecosystem mapping, forest loss driver classification, carbon sequestration, wildfire risk mapping, and land cover change detection. Challenges
Research Challenges : Advancing foundation models for geospatial intelligence; addressing domain adaptation, low-resource settings, and high-impact decision-making; and minimizing the cost of annotating high-quality, large-scale geospatial datasets Engineering Challenges : Scaling model training and inference responsibly, efficiently, and cost-effectively—particularly for users with limited compute or edge deployments beyond WiFi range. Product & Deployment : Building robust AI-first tools that enable scientists, policymakers, and conservationists to generate
actionable intelligence
with minimal friction. Responsibilities
